服务器和数据库有什么关系

飞飞 其他 0

回复

共3条回复 我来回复
  • 飞飞的头像
    飞飞
    Worktile&PingCode市场小伙伴
    评论

    服务器和数据库是两个不同的概念,但它们之间有着密切的关系。

    1. 存储和管理数据:数据库是用于存储和管理数据的软件系统,而服务器是用于提供计算资源和网络连接的硬件设备。服务器可以托管数据库,提供给用户访问和操作数据的服务。

    2. 数据库的安装和配置:在服务器上安装和配置数据库软件,使其能够正常运行。服务器的性能和配置对数据库的性能和稳定性有着重要影响。

    3. 数据库的备份和恢复:服务器可以定期备份数据库的数据,以防止数据丢失或损坏。在服务器上保存数据库备份文件,以便在需要时进行恢复操作。

    4. 数据库的性能优化:服务器的性能和配置对数据库的性能优化起着至关重要的作用。通过调整服务器的资源分配和优化数据库的索引、查询等操作,可以提高数据库的性能和响应速度。

    5. 数据库的访问权限管理:服务器可以提供访问控制和权限管理的功能,用于保护数据库的安全性。通过服务器的用户认证和授权机制,可以限制用户对数据库的访问和操作权限,防止未经授权的访问和数据泄露。

    总之,服务器和数据库之间的关系是密切的,服务器提供了数据库运行所需的计算资源和网络连接,并负责数据库的安装、配置、备份和恢复等操作,同时还提供访问控制和权限管理的功能,保证数据库的安全性和性能。

    5个月前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    服务器和数据库是紧密相关的两个概念,它们之间存在着密切的关系。

    首先,服务器是一种硬件设备,它提供了计算资源和存储空间,用于运行和管理各种软件应用程序。服务器可以是物理服务器,也可以是虚拟服务器。

    数据库则是一种用于存储和管理数据的软件系统。它可以在服务器上安装和运行,也可以在客户端设备上运行。数据库系统提供了一种结构化的方式来组织和访问数据,以便用户可以方便地存储、查询和更新数据。

    服务器和数据库之间的关系体现在以下几个方面:

    1. 数据库存储:服务器提供了存储空间,用于存储数据库的数据文件。数据库可以将数据存储在服务器的硬盘上,以便长期保存和持久化。

    2. 数据库管理:服务器上安装了数据库软件,用于管理和操作数据库。数据库软件提供了管理工具和接口,使得用户可以对数据库进行配置、备份、恢复、性能优化等操作。

    3. 数据库访问:服务器上运行的应用程序可以通过网络连接到数据库,使用数据库的API或查询语言来访问和操作数据库中的数据。服务器作为中介,将应用程序和数据库之间的请求和响应进行转发和处理。

    4. 数据库性能:服务器的性能对数据库的运行和访问速度有重要影响。服务器的处理能力、存储容量和网络带宽等因素都会影响数据库的性能。因此,服务器的选择和配置对数据库的性能优化非常重要。

    总之,服务器和数据库之间存在着密切的关系。服务器提供了运行和存储数据库所需的资源,而数据库则利用服务器的资源来管理和存储数据。服务器和数据库的协同工作,使得应用程序可以高效地访问和操作数据,满足用户的需求。

    5个月前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    服务器和数据库是密切相关的两个概念,它们之间存在着紧密的关系。服务器是一台能够提供服务的计算机,可以存储、处理和传输数据。而数据库则是一种用于存储和管理数据的软件系统。下面将从方法、操作流程等方面来讲解服务器和数据库之间的关系。

    一、服务器和数据库的关系

    1. 数据存储:服务器是用来存储数据的计算机,而数据库则是数据的存储介质。数据库可以将数据进行组织和管理,提供高效的数据访问和存储功能。服务器通过数据库来存储数据,以便在需要的时候进行读取和处理。

    2. 数据处理:服务器可以通过数据库来进行数据处理。数据库提供了强大的数据处理功能,如查询、排序、过滤等。服务器可以利用数据库的功能来对数据进行处理和分析,以满足用户的需求。

    3. 数据传输:服务器和数据库之间的数据传输是通过网络进行的。服务器可以通过网络连接到数据库,将数据从服务器发送到数据库进行存储,或者从数据库读取数据到服务器进行处理。数据库也可以通过网络连接到服务器,将数据发送给服务器进行处理。

    二、服务器和数据库的操作流程

    1. 安装和配置服务器:首先需要安装和配置服务器。安装服务器操作系统,并进行相应的配置,如设置网络、安装防火墙等。然后安装服务器软件,如Web服务器、应用服务器等。

    2. 安装和配置数据库:安装数据库软件,并进行相应的配置。配置数据库的参数,如内存大小、磁盘空间等。创建数据库实例,设置数据库的用户名和密码等。

    3. 连接服务器和数据库:在服务器上配置数据库连接。通过设置数据库连接字符串、用户名和密码等,将服务器与数据库连接起来。可以使用数据库连接池来提高连接的效率和性能。

    4. 数据存储和处理:服务器通过数据库将数据存储到数据库中。可以使用SQL语句来插入、更新和删除数据。可以使用数据库事务来保证数据的一致性和完整性。服务器也可以通过数据库查询数据,使用SQL语句来查询和过滤数据。

    5. 数据传输和交互:服务器和数据库之间的数据传输是通过网络进行的。服务器可以将数据发送到数据库进行存储和处理,也可以从数据库读取数据进行处理和展示。可以使用网络协议来实现数据的传输和交互,如HTTP、TCP/IP等。

    6. 监控和管理:服务器和数据库都需要进行监控和管理。可以通过监控工具来监控服务器和数据库的运行状态和性能指标。可以进行性能优化和故障排查,以保证服务器和数据库的稳定和可靠运行。

    三、总结

    服务器和数据库之间存在着密切的关系。服务器通过数据库来存储和处理数据,提供数据的访问和传输功能。数据库则依赖于服务器来提供计算资源和网络连接,以实现数据的存储和处理。服务器和数据库的操作流程涉及到安装、配置、连接、存储、处理、传输、监控和管理等多个环节,需要综合考虑各个方面的因素,以保证服务器和数据库的正常运行和高效性能。

    5个月前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部